Alphis James Mazingo

Funeral Services for Alphis James Mazingo, 36 of Picayune, Miss., who passed away Thursday, December 12, 2013, will be held Monday, December 16, 2013, at 11:00 am at McDonald Funeral Home Chapel.

Visitation will be Sunday, December 15, 2013 from 6:00 pm until 9:00 pm at McDonald Funeral Home.

Burial will be in New Palestine Cemetery under the direction of McDonald Funeral Home.

Bro. Phil Pearson will officiate the service.

A native of Picayune, he was a Supervisor in the Oil Industry and a member of Parkview Baptist Church. He served as a Seabee for six years in the United States Navy. He was a loving, devoted father and son who will be sadly missed.

He was preceded in death by his grandmother, Betty J. Kellar; his grandfather, Robert Andrew Campbell; his grandmother, Patricia Mazingo; and his grandfather, Joseph L. Lafferty.

Survivors include his parents, Joseph N. Lafferty and Brenda J. Lafferty; his daughter, Shelby M. Mazingo; his son, Jeremy N. Mazingo; his sister, Christy J. Lafferty;  his girlfriend, Kelly L. Edward; and his step grandfather, Alphis James Mazingo.
